Genesis 36:1
🇮🇱 BIBLICAL HEBREW

📖 King James Version

Now these are the generations of Esau, who is Edom.

🔤 Interlinear Analysis — Hebrew (BDB)

# Hebrew Transliteration Strong's Morphology Translation Definition
1 וְ/אֵ֛לֶּה אֵ֫לֶּה H428 HC/Pdxcp אֵ֫לֶּה prolonged from אֵל; these or those: an- (the) other; one sort, so, some, such, them, these (same), they, this, those, thus, which, who(-m).
2 תֹּלְד֥וֹת תּוֹלְדוֹת H8435 HNcfpc תּוֹלְדוֹת or toldah; from יָלַד; (plural only) descent, i.e. family; (figuratively) history: birth, generations.
3 עֵשָׂ֖ו עֵשָׂו H6215 HNp עֵשָׂו apparently a form of the passive participle of עָשָׂה in the original sense of handling; rough (i.e. sensibly felt); Esav, a son of Isaac, including his posterity: Esau.
4 ה֥וּא הוּא H1931 HPp3ms הוּא of which the feminine (beyond the Pentateuch) is hiyw; a primitive word, the third person pronoun singular, he (she or it); only expressed when emphatic or without a verb; also (intensively) self, or (especially with the article) the same; sometimes (as demonstrative) this or that; occasionally (instead of copula) as or are: he, as for her, him(-self), it, the same, she (herself), such, that (...it), these, they, this, those, which (is), who.
5 אֱדֽוֹם אֱדוֹם H123 HNp אֱדוֹם or (fully) Edowm; from אָדֹם; red (see Gen. 25:25); Edom, the elder twin-brother of Jacob; hence the region (Idumaea) occupied by him: Edom, Edomites, Idumea.
